MINUTES — Management Meeting, Ferrowick Industries
Prepared for: the Board

The regional sales review covered all four territories. Norgate exceeded target by 9%; Ellsmere and Cawdry met plan; Vintham fell 12% short, attributed to delayed stock of the Marlowe range. Actions: Vintham lead to present a recovery plan within two weeks; pricing review for the Marlowe range deferred to next quarter. The confidential note on forward business plans is appended immediately below.

board note of kageg-bahof: The renewal with Holwynax Holdings closes at $2 million a year, 5 percent below the last contract. Project Ulaath slips by two quarters because of the supplier delay.

**14:22** — Okay, this is where it gets interesting. The bloom filter fronting the Marrowvale KV store had silently saturated after the bulk import, so basically every lookup fell through to disk. Latency tripled, but nothing crashed, which is why alerts stayed quiet for forty minutes. No evidence of tampering — just bad capacity math. For the security review, the exact artifact running at the time is pinned by the token below.

pipeline stamp: htk9_ce63042d9

CI note — Murrow Hall Audio Guide. Pipeline failed on the signing stage; the provisioning profile in the Calder runner expired. Rotated it, re-ran, green. No source changes involved; artifact hashes match the prior run except the signature block. Security review should confirm the re-signed bundle before distribution. The relevant build token is recorded directly below.

session token of yajof-bagef = htk4_937d

## Deploying the Thumbnail Queue

Welcome aboard! The Snapcrate thumbnail queue takes uploaded images and fans them out to resize workers. Deploys are pretty painless: push to the release branch and the pipeline handles the rest. Two things to watch — don't scale workers past the GPU node count, and always drain the queue before a schema bump, or you'll get half-processed images stuck forever. If something looks off after deploy, check the worker logs first. The queue reads these configuration values at startup.

deployment values, kahof-yadug:
[gorys]
team = silael
access_code = ac_00d620
owner = istox.oliys
host = gorys.torvastack.example
port = 9000
peer = holmir.merlaqsoft.example
salt = 9fdae78a
pin = 2358